Is it possible? Let's say for instance that I have a gem of a certain cut; what's the best way to stick that in a saber hilt so that it will both stay firmly in and still look good?

I'd say that if you drilled a hole and had the gem mounted on a stud earring setting, and then set the stud in the drilled out hole.
I might suggest two screws at opposing poles, each of which can slightly tap into the gem a little bit, thereby holding it in place.
For added certainty that the gem will stay, you might slightly drill out little grooves/holes in the gem so that the screws recess into the gem a little bit... maybe 1/4"? 1/8"?
